如何使用 Angular ui-grid 使分页工作/控件显示?有人成功完成过吗?
我知道 tutorial 。
我尝试过但不起作用的事情:
- 使用教程作为指南。
- 在我的项目之外重新制作示例。
- 使用不同版本的 ui-grid;我尝试过 RC.12 - RC.21。
- 使用不同版本的 angularjs;我尝试过 1.2.26 - 1.3.15。
我知道 ui.grid.pagination
模块位于我正在使用的 ui-grid js 文件中,并且它正在被我的 Controller 拾取。我通过更改 ui-grid js 文件中指令的名称对此进行了测试。
来自 Controller 的代码:
var app = angular.module('myApp', ['ui.grid', 'ui.grid.pagination', 'ngAnimate', 'ngTouch']);
app.controller('myCtrl', ['$scope', '$http', function ($scope, $http) {
$scope.gridOptions = {
enablePagination: true,
enableFiltering: true,
enableSorting: true,
enableHorizontalScrollbar: false,
enablePaginationControls: true,
paginationPageSizes: [25, 50, 75],
paginationPageSize: 25,
}
HTML:
<div class="container-fluid">
<h1>Processes</h1>
<div ng-controller="myCtrl">
<div ui-grid="gridOptions" ui.grid.pagination></div>
</div>
</div>
最佳答案
您在 html 中放置了 ui.grid.pagination
而不是 ui-grid-pagination
。
关于javascript - Angular ui-grid 分页 v3.0.0-RC.18 不起作用,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/30465577/